ORDER
This writ petition is filed praying to direct the third respondent herein to take over the Administration of the "Sri Venkatachalapathy Swamy Temple" at No.38, Rayanthur Village, Thanjavur Taluk by considering the representation of the petitioner dated 06.05.2022 and by implementing the order passed by the first respondent in his proceedings in Na.Ka.A2/4110/2022 dated 31.05.2022.
2.It is submitted that the petitioner is a resident of Thanjavur. There is a Village Temple in the name of Sri Venkatachalapathy Swamy Temple, in which the ancestral deity Katteri Amman and other deities are placed and worshipped by the people belonging to the petitioner's community. It is submitted that the ancestors of the petitioner gifted 64 cents of land as Inam for the purpose of Pooja Expenses and maintenance of
the Temple and the same is also reflected in the relevant revenue records. However, during the year 2017, there were certain issues raised by a group including one Soundar. Pursuant to which, a suit in O.S.No.48 of 2017 was filed for declaration to declare the petitioner as "First Karaitharar". The said suit is stated to be pending and it is submitted that the property is being encroached by third parties. In view of the same, the petitioner submitted a representation dated 06.05.2022, to the first respondent, requesting to take over the temple and its property. Pursuant to which, the first respondent issued a proceedings dated 31.05.2022 directing the 3rd Respondent to take appropriate action on the representation of the petitioner. The petitioner also submitted the representation to Chief Minister's Special Cell and Secretarty to Government, Hindu Religious and Charitable Endowments Department on 06.05.2022, however, the same is pending consideration. Aggrieved by the inaction of the respondents the petitioner has filed the present writ petition.
3.Mr.P.Subbaraj, learned Special Government Pleader, appearing on behalf of the respondents submitted that the above representation shall
be considered and appropriate orders will be passed in accordance with law. 4.Considering the limited scope of the prayer sought for in this writ petition, there shall be a direction to the appropriate respondent to consider the representaion of the petitioner, dated 06.05.2022 and pass appropriate orders on merits and in accordance with law, within period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order, after affording a reasonable opportunity to the petitioner and other stake holders/interested parties, if any. It is made clear that this Court has not expressed any views with regard to the merits of the representation and it is open to the respondents to consider the representation on its own merits. 5.With the above direction, this writ petition is disposed of.
